TitleLetter. Pascoe Grenfell (Westminster) to Matthew Boulton [Soho].
LevelItem
Date23 January 1805
Description(Dated at the House of Commons, six o’clock.) [I have this moment left Mr. Rose. I stated to him last week’s ticketing price: since we sold you the 600 tons, the standard has advanced from 145 to £162 10s.: consequently there must be a great loss in supplying the copper upon the terms first proposed. He said it was not the wish of Government that any person should lose by it, and advises an application by you for revising the terms of your contract. No doubt you will no longer hesitate to apply for such terms as are consistent with the present situation of the copper trade. The number of pieces coined should be 52 [per lb.] instead of 48.]
